2024 Annual General Meeting

 

We held our AGM on Thursday 16th January 2025, at Ystradgynlais Community Centre.

Our Chairman, Andrew Borsden, chaired a packed agenda: we heard a summary of all of BGC Wales’ activity from the past year from our CEO Grant; our Treasurer Rob Williams, alongside our Auditor, gave a financial summary; our Sports Panel leads updated us on all of the sporting activity through the year; and of course the stars of the show were our young people, Martha, Rhiannon and Lily who stood up to talk about their experiences overseas. It’s been an incredible year and our young people have achieved so much, we’re really proud of all of you!

Importantly, we also reappointed three of our Trustees who were up for nomination following retirement by rotation. Congratulations to Robert Fussell,  Alan Howells and Steve Khaireh. Meet our full Board of Trustees here.

Following formalities, we also introduced to you our new online learning platform, CADEMI. This is available free of charge to club leaders and volunteers - there are hundreds of off-the-shelf courses available on a range of topics, but we here at BGC Wales have produced 4 courses which we’re really happy to share and hope you find useful:

  • Introduction to Youth Work 

  • Setting up a Youth Club

  • Safeguarding Group A Wales

  • Get Ready..Get Set..Fundraise (Coming Soon)

2024 NABGC Conference

The Conference & Awards Evening was a resounding success, celebrating a vibrant and inspiring gathering of youth leaders, mentors, and community champions from across the UK and America. The event showcased the organisation’s continued commitment to empowering young people, recognising outstanding achievements, and sharing innovative approaches to youth development.

Held in a spirit of unity and collaboration, the conference featured engaging workshops, keynote speakers, and discussions on best practices in youth work in the theme of Quality Matters. Attendees gained valuable insights, practical tools, and inspiration to continue fostering positive change in their communities. The Awards Evening was the highlight of the event, where individuals and clubs were honoured for their dedication, creativity, and impact, spotlighting the incredible work done to uplift young people.

This year’s NABGC conference reflected the strength and diversity of the organisation, leaving participants feeling motivated, connected, and equipped to make even greater strides in supporting the next generation. The atmosphere was one of celebration and optimism, setting a new benchmark for future events.
